About The Position

Labcorp is seeking a Clinical Lab Technician to join our Invitae Genetics lab in San Francisco, CA. This is a great entry-level opportunity to join an innovative laboratory and receive training that will help the individual grow in a career in the molecular diagnostics field. The role involves supporting diagnostic testing on patient specimens using a variety of molecular assays and platforms for Invitae, part of Labcorp. Under supervision, the technician will assist licensed CLS personnel in performing clinical tests according to established procedures and state regulations. The position requires attention to detail in sample preparation, inventory management, and adherence to quality control guidelines to ensure the integrity of laboratory results and a safe work environment.

Responsibilities

  • Under supervision of licensed personnel, support diagnostic testing on patient specimens using a variety of molecular assays and platforms for Invitae, part of Labcorp
  • Assist licensed CLS personnel who are performing clinical test protocols using established procedures (in accordance with state regulations)
  • Identify any issues that may adversely affect the quality of test results and escalates these to appropriate representatives to ensure prompt resolution
  • Identify, prioritize, and prepare all clinical samples while ensuring viability and sample integrity throughout the test process
  • Maintain inventory and organization of specimen samples in the freezer
  • Prepare and label tubes and plates according to established protocols
  • Prepare clinical samples for testing and identify sample related issues
  • Assist coordinating documentation
  • Monitor and maintain consumable inventory including reagents and supplies for each of the laboratory workstations
  • Perform general laboratory, equipment, and benchtop clean-up
  • Prepare logs or other documents for routine testing or special assignments
  • Adhere to quality control guidelines to ensure integrity of laboratory specimens
  • Under the direct supervision of a licensed CLS, dispense pre-made and prequalified reagents/controls using a pre-programmed fixed volume measuring devices
  • Provide laboratory support in the maintenance and surface decontamination of general laboratory equipment
  • Maintain a safe work environment and wears appropriate personal protective equipment
